How Payment Arrangements Actually Work
Payment arrangements structure purchases or recurring charges into manageable installments, often with zero interest and transparent terms. Unlike traditional credit, these plans require no long-term financial commitment—users pay in predictable chunks aligned with income cycles. A typical setup includes a base amount, repayment period (usually 3–12 months), and clear fees or interest (if applicable). Most plans avoid hidden costs, clearly outlining responsibilities on platforms and agreements. This clarity reduces uncertainty and supports responsible use, making financial planning more manageable.

Q: Do payment arrangements count as credit?
Most are structured as flexible payment plans, not loans. None create credit history or carry typical interest unless specified. No hard inquiries or debt obligations.
Q: Who can access them?
Platforms increasingly offer them to adults with valid payment methods and verifiable income. Eligibility depends on program rules, not guaranteed approval—useful for everyday expenses, tech purchases, and services.
Q: Are there risks?
Misuse can lead to missed payments, but responsible platforms enforce reminders and grace periods. Late fees or balance accrual, if elected, remain transparent. Most users report stable repayment without long-term debt.
Q: Can payment arrangements replace credit cards?
They serve different purposes. Arrangements offer budget predictability and installment choice without compounding interest. Use combined for large purchases or essential recurring costs.
